MINISCAN IR Vision Fuel Analyzer

The MINISCAN IR Vision is the is a high speed, compact and robust FTIR fuel analyzer for the comprehensive and automatic measurement of gasoline, jet and diesel fuels.More than 100 fuel parameters are accurately determined by scanning the complete spectrum with superior resolution. Based on Grabner Instruments profound knowledge in fuel analysis, the MINISCAN IR Vision is designed as an intelligent, self-learning analyzer.

The MINISCAN IR Vision is a completely temperature regulated, robust and user friendly spectrometer for the automatic measurement of concentration of the most important components of gasoline and diesel. Advanced chemometrics, a worldwide database of calibration samples and information derived from the complete spectrum rather than from specific peaks provide highly reliable results for concentration measurement and key properties such as Octane and Cetane Numbers, Distillation Properties and Vapor Pressure. An integrated temperature controlled density meter allows for exact determination and stability of fuel density.

Data based on real samples collected and analyzed by SGS

For predicted properties, MINISCAN IR Vision operates calibration data, that has to adhere to the strictest quality standards. As a unique feature the instrument is equipped with a database of samples that have been collected and analysed by SGS!

Maximizing Ease of Use

MINISCAN IR Visiont is equipped with a high-performance processor, which allows the user to calculate results within seconds. A high end full color touch-screen facilitates menu navigation and allows in depth spectrum analysis. USB and Ethernet interfaces facilitate quick data-transfer, printing, LIMS integration and remote control and service. For field use, the MINISCAN IR Vision can be run with a 12V car adapter.

Specifications
 

Standards

ASTM D1655, D5845, D6277, D7777, D7806; EN 238, EN 14078; ISO 15212;

Correlation to

ASTM D56/D3828, D86, D323, D445, D1319, D1322, D1655, D1840, D2386/D7153, D3948, D5191, D6371, D6378, D6379, D613, D2699, D2700; ISO 3104, 3405, 5163, 5164, 5165; EN 116, EN 13016;

Spectrometer

Temperature and Laser Regulated, 2+1 Cell-FTIR

Density Measurement

Temperature Regulated Oscillating U-Tube Cell

Warm Up / Scanning Time

1 min. / 80s (Multiple Scans)

Units of Measurement

v%, m%

Touch-Screen

10” full color touch screen

Interfaces

2x USB, 2x LAN

Power Supply

100-264 V AC, 47-63 Hz, 130 W (field application with DC adaptor for 12 V vehicle battery)

Dimensions / Weight

293 x 390 x 280 mm (10.5 x 15.4 x 11 inch), 12 kg (26 lb)
